Abstract :
This research presents an innovative system for managing access control and real-time data flow within a decentralized supply chain. Leveraging blockchain technology, specifically Hyperledger Fabric, in conjunction with IPFS for off-chain decentralized storage, this system facilitates real-time access to IoT network data by various supply chain participants. This real-time access enhances transparency, enables continuous quality control through monitoring, and ensures data security and immutability. The system introduces a novel access control scheme, R2-BAC, which integrates both role-based and rule-based approaches, offering flexibility in defining access levels. Furthermore, the system has been rigorously evaluated and tested under varying numbers of concurrent requests, demonstrating promising scalability and performance when compared to existing models.
